An American contributor to our conference has incorporated some images into their presentation as “fair use”. Can I put their PowerPoint presentation up onto our Web site?

0

It would be unwise to publish the PowerPoint presentation on a UK Web site on this basis. The US concept of “fair use” is more generous to educators than UK Copyright’s “fair dealing”, but even the US Law is unlikely to allow such use. It would be sensible to ask the academic to get appropriate permission.
